At Aldi, no day is the same. Every day brings something new - you'll be at the heart of the store, ensuring everything runs seamlessly. From receiving deliveries and stocking shelves to assisting customers and creating a welcoming atmosphere, your role is vital. Become part of a fast paced, friendly team where every colleague contributes to creating an exceptional shopping experience.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ide friendly, efficient customer service
  • Stock shelves quickly and present products to look their best
  • Check deliveries and product quality, removing items that don't meet Aldi standards
Skills & Experience
  • Friendly, approachable, and ready to support customers and the team
  • Comfortable with replenishing stock at pace to ensure the best availability for customers
  • Reliable and flexible with a can-do attitude in a fast-moving environment
  • Retail experience is a plus but not essential - attitude matters most!
Our Benefits
  • Competitive salary
  • A flexible contract between 10-20 hours per week
  • 28 days annual leave which includes bank holidays
  • Access to an online wellness portal and 24/7 Employee Assistance programme
  • 26 weeks full pay following 1 year service for Maternity and Main Adopter Leave
  • Comprehensive training and ongoing development

Before you apply: Shifts can start as early as 6am and finish as late as 10pm (stores vary). Please ensure you have reliable transport options to get to store for these times before applying.

How to prepare for a job interview at Aldi Stores

Know the Role Inside Out

Before your interview, make sure you understand what being a Stock Assistant at Aldi entails. Familiarise yourself with the key responsibilities like stocking shelves and providing customer service.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

Show Off Your People Skills

Since the job involves interacting with customers and working as part of a team, be prepared to demonstrate your friendly and approachable nature. Think of examples from past experiences where you've provided excellent customer service or worked well in a team. This will highlight your suitability for the fast-paced environment.

Emphasise Your Flexibility

Aldi values reliability and flexibility, so be ready to discuss your availability and willingness to adapt to different shifts. Mention any previous experience where you had to be flexible or work under pressure, as this will show that you can thrive in a dynamic setting.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team culture, training opportunities, or how success is measured in the role. This not only shows your interest but also helps you determine if Aldi is the right fit for you.
